Buying Guide
Relay modules are essential tools for controlling high-power devices safely with low-power signals. Whether you’re building a smart home or a DIY project, the right relay module makes it easy. Let’s explore the best options and what to consider when buying.
Factors to Consider When Buying Relay Modules
- Voltage Compatibility:
Choose a module that matches your project’s voltage, like 5V or 12V. This ensures safe and efficient operation. - Channel Count:
Decide how many devices you need to control. Options range from 1-channel to 16-channel modules. - Load Capacity:
Check the module’s current and voltage ratings (e.g., 10A, 250V AC) to ensure it handles your devices safely. - Trigger Type:
Look for high/low level trigger options to match your microcontroller’s output signals. - Optocoupler Isolation:
Optocoupler isolation protects your microcontroller from damage by separating control and relay circuits. - Compatibility:
Ensure the module works with your platform, like Arduino, Raspberry Pi, or MCU. - Ease of Use:
Features like screw terminals, LED indicators, and fault-tolerant design make setup and troubleshooting simpler. - Pack Size:
Some modules come in packs of 4, 6, or 10, offering better value for multiple projects.
